MoAD Mix: Black PRIDE

In celebration of Pride Month, June’s MoAD Mix uplifts the voices and visions of Black LGBTQIA+ artists whose identities and practices challenge convention, claim space, and radiate joy. Join us for Black PRIDE, a spirited conversation exploring the intersections of Blackness, queerness, and creative expression. Together, we’ll spotlight artists who embody liberation through their work—whether by honoring ancestral lineages, disrupting gender norms, or envisioning new, affirming futures. This month’s program is a vibrant homage to the resilience, brilliance, and beauty of Black queer life.
